Bridged bicyclic heteroaryl substituted triazoles useful as Axl inhibitors
View Patent ↗Bridged bicyclic heteroaryl substituted triazoles and pharmaceutical compositions containing the compounds are disclosed as being useful in inhibiting the activity of the receptor protein tyrosine kinase Axl. Methods of using the compounds in treating diseases or conditions associated with Axl activity are also disclosed.

3. A pharmaceutical composition comprising a pharmaceutically acceptable excipient and a therapeutically effective amount of compound of claim 1 , as an isolated stereoisomer or a mixture thereof, or as a pharmaceutically acceptable salt thereof.
4. A method of treating a disease or condition associated with Axl activity in a mammal, wherein the disease or condition is selected from the group consisting of rheumatoid arthritis, vascular disease, vascular injury, psoriasis, visual impairment due to macular degeneration, diabetic retinopathy, retinopathy of prematurity, kidney disease, osteoporosis, osteoarthritis, cataracts, breast carcinoma, renal carcinoma, endometrial carcinoma, ovarian carcinoma, thyroid carcinoma, non-small cell lung carcinoma, melanoma, prostate carcinoma, sarcoma, gastric cancer, uveal melanoma, myeloid leukemia, lymphoma and endometriosis, and wherein the method comprises administering to the mammal a therapeutically effective amount of a compound of claim 1 , as an isolated stereoisomer or a mixture thereof, or a pharmaceutically acceptable salt thereof.
5. A method of inhibiting Axl activity in a cell, wherein the method comprises contacting the cell with an effective amount of a compound of claim 1 , as an isolated stereoisomer or a mixture thereof, or as a pharmaceutically acceptable salt thereof.
